After cutting a 4-meter-long cylindrical steel into two equal sections, the surface area increases by 0.28 square decimeter. If each cubic decimeter of steel weighs 7.8 kg, this will be a big problem How many kilos does the root weigh?

After the cylindrical steel is cut into two equal sections, the surface area of the two cylinders increases
Bottom area: 0.28 △ 2 = 0.14 (square decimeter)
4m = 40m
Volume of cylinder: 0.14 × 40 = 5.6 (cubic decimeter)
Weight: 5.6 × 7.8 = 43.68 (kg)
